Reggae kings Easy Star All Stars are set to give the Fab Four a Jamaican reworking with the release of their new album 'Easy Star's Lonely Hearts Dub Band'.

A collective containing some of the finest reggae musicians on the planet, Easy Star All Stars released their debut album 'Dub Side Of The Moon'. A reggae reworking of the Pink Floyg prog classic, it took the hugely acclaimed record and flung it into the echo chamber. What emerged was a surprise success, uniting the dystopic gloom of the original was a redemptive slice of reggae soul.

After a number of hit tours, Easy Star All Stars repeated the trick with the release of 'Radiodread' in 2006. Containing a number of skanking rewrites of Thom Yorke & Co., the album contained such stunning delights as Horace Andy singing 'Airbag'.

Forthcoming album 'Easy Star's Lonely Heart Dub Band' repeats the never-boring puns of the previous releases. Featuring guest stars such as Steel Pulse, Matisyahu, Michael Rose (Black Uhuru), Luciano, U Roy and many more, this album unites some of the finest talent on the Jamaican music scene. What will a reggae version of 'A Day In The Life' sound like? We have but weeks until we find out.

Easy Star All Stars release 'Easy Star's Lonely Hearts Dub Band' on April 14th.
